SDOT announces lane closures on Aurora & Magnolia bridges next week

The Seattle Department of Transportation has just announced two planned lane closures on the Aurora and Magnolia bridges next week.

From 9 a.m. to 2:30 p.m. on Monday, March 8 to Wednesday March 9, crews will close the eastbound and westbound lanes of the Magnolia Bridge one at a time while crews repair expansion joints.

On Wednesday March 10 from 9 a.m. to 2:30 p.m. the southbound, right-hand lane on the Aurora Bridge will be closed while crews complete repairs to the underside of the bridge.

Keep this in mind when traveling over both bridges next week–added traffic is expected. SDOT also reminds commuters that the work is subject to change “in the event crews are called to perform unplanned, emergency work at other locations.”
